MSIX Set Installation Path

    Hi Archana2240 

     

    The installation path of an MSIX package cannot be changed. All the files you have included in your package are installed inside an app-specific folder under "C:\Program Files\WindowsApps<your app>\".

    This is a design decision from Microsoft. Only for MSI/EXE installers you can change the install path.

     

    If you want to add files in other folders too, you need to copy them the first time your application is launched. For that, you have multiple options. You can write your own code inside your application to copy the files in other folders or you can use third-party MSIX packaging tools to help you do it.
